What is tokenomics?
Tokenomics refers to the analysis of the design, supply and use of a cryptocurrency. It implies studying the economy and mechanics behind a project, including factors such as market demand, adoption rates and the effects of the network. Tokenomics helps developers to create more sustainable and resistant blockchain ecosystems by understanding how different interested parties interact with their projects.
